First off, let's get into what MIM lock parts are. MIM is a super cool manufacturing process that combines the best of plastic injection molding and powder metallurgy. It allows us to make complex - shaped parts with high precision, which is a big plus for lock components. Locks need parts that fit together just right, and MIM can deliver that.
Now, onto the coating. A high - quality coating on MIM lock parts is crucial for a bunch of reasons. One of the main reasons is protection. Locks are often exposed to all sorts of elements. They can get wet, be in contact with chemicals, or just face normal wear and tear from everyday use. A good coating acts as a shield, preventing corrosion and rust.

So, how do we make sure MIM lock parts have a high - quality coating? Well, it starts with the selection of the right coating material. There are different types of coatings available, like zinc plating, nickel plating, and epoxy coatings. Each has its own advantages.
Zinc plating is a popular choice because it's relatively inexpensive and provides good corrosion resistance. It forms a protective layer on the surface of the MIM part, acting as a barrier against moisture and oxygen. Nickel plating, on the other hand, gives a more decorative finish and can also offer better wear resistance. Epoxy coatings are great for their chemical resistance and can be used in harsh environments.

Once we've selected the coating material, the application process is crucial. We use advanced coating techniques to ensure an even and uniform coating. One of the methods we use is electroplating. In electroplating, the MIM lock part is submerged in a solution containing metal ions, and an electric current is passed through it. This causes the metal ions to deposit on the surface of the part, forming a thin, even coating.
We also have strict quality control measures in place during the coating process. We inspect each part to make sure the coating thickness is within the specified range, and there are no defects like bubbles or uneven coverage.
